I will therefore that men pray every where, lifting up holy hands, without wrath and doubting. (1 Timothy 2:8 KJV) Prayer is a strong avenue of our communication to our Heavenly Father. If we had no other way to communicate than just reading His Word, our lives would be fruitless and incomplete. He does communicate to us through the power if His Word. Prayer brings us closer to Him. We may pray on bended knees, flat on our faces in constant turmoil, standing with hands straight up, lifting them to Heaven in honor and praise of a mighty and glorious God. Whatever position we take, the important factor is that we are reaching out to Him. Our prayers can take several forms, soft and melodious as the Psalms of comfort. Constant perhaps repetitious, questioning-as-in WHY? Trust as we seek guidance and His comfort, love and joy. Intercessory, as we pray for others. I like to define prayer this way; A.C.T.S - Adoration- giving to Him first of all praise and adoration for who He is. Confession- bringing myself to Him for complete cleansing and restoration. Thanksgiving, thanking Him for all He has done, is doing and will continue to do in my life as well as others. Supplication, bringing others to Him, seeking guidance to reach out to those I meet daily. Lift up your voice as you speak to Him today. Sweet hour of prayer! sweet hour of prayer!
